Difference between revisions of "ECOM 1F0 2018-19 BTB JHipster Registry"

From air
Jump to navigation Jump to search
Line 1: Line 1:
 
= Fonctionnalités =
 
= Fonctionnalités =
* Serveur Eureka
+
* [https://www.jhipster.tech/jhipster-registry/#eureka Serveur Eureka]
  +
** Gestion de la mise à l'échelle
  +
** Gestion de la charge
  +
** Gestion du routage
  +
** Découverte des services et instances
  +
** Mise à l'échelle du cache automatique
  +
  +
* [https://www.jhipster.tech/jhipster-registry/#spring-cloud-config Serveur de configuration Spring Cloud]
  +
** Configuration de l'application en temps réel
  +
** Configuration stockée sur serveur central
  +
** Possibilité de stocker la configuration sur git
  +
  +
* [https://www.jhipster.tech/jhipster-registry/#dashboards Serveur d'administration]
  +
** Contrôle de l'application
  +
** Gestion de l'application
  +
** Interface visuelle
  +
** Configuration centralisée et simplifiée
  +
** Affichage d'informations sur:
  +
*** la JVM
  +
*** les requêtes HTTP
  +
*** les méthodes utilisant Spring Beans
  +
*** le pool de connexion à la base de données
   
 
= Avantages =
 
= Avantages =
 
* Open-source
 
* Open-source
 
* Interface moderne basée sur Angular
 
* Interface moderne basée sur Angular
  +
* Temps réel
  +
* Adapté à une architecture services
   
 
= Inconvénients =
 
= Inconvénients =
  +
* Besoin d'installer l'application
  +
* Ne fonctionne qu'avec les applications utilisant [https://fr.wikipedia.org/wiki/JSON_Web_Token JWT]
   
 
= Sources =
 
= Sources =

Revision as of 12:04, 16 October 2018

Fonctionnalités

  • Serveur Eureka
    • Gestion de la mise à l'échelle
    • Gestion de la charge
    • Gestion du routage
    • Découverte des services et instances
    • Mise à l'échelle du cache automatique
  • Serveur d'administration
    • Contrôle de l'application
    • Gestion de l'application
    • Interface visuelle
    • Configuration centralisée et simplifiée
    • Affichage d'informations sur:
      • la JVM
      • les requêtes HTTP
      • les méthodes utilisant Spring Beans
      • le pool de connexion à la base de données

Avantages

  • Open-source
  • Interface moderne basée sur Angular
  • Temps réel
  • Adapté à une architecture services

Inconvénients

  • Besoin d'installer l'application
  • Ne fonctionne qu'avec les applications utilisant JWT

Sources